Browse Source

Display data

Samson Mutunga 3 năm trước cách đây
mục cha
commit
dc2cdba5fa

+ 23 - 0
resources/views/app/patient/intake-data/patient-intake-data-display.blade.php

@@ -0,0 +1,23 @@
+<?php
+	$patientIntakeData = json_decode($patient->canvas_data ?? null);
+	$fields = [
+		'height',
+		'weight',
+		'last_vitamin_d',
+		''
+	];
+?>
+<div class="table-responsive">
+	<table class="table table-sm table-striped table-bordered">
+		<tr>
+		<th colspan="2">Patient Intake Data</th>
+		</tr>
+		<?php 
+			for($i = 0; $i < count($patientIntakeData); $i++): ?>
+		<tr>
+			<td>df</td>
+			<td>dffg</td>
+		</tr>
+		<?php endfor; ?>
+	</table>
+</div>

+ 5 - 1
resources/views/layouts/patient-intake-data-form.blade.php → resources/views/app/patient/intake-data/patient-intake-data-form.blade.php

@@ -1,8 +1,11 @@
 <div id="patient-intake-data-form" visit-moe moe relative wide class="ml-2 hide-inside-popup">
 	<a start show><i class="fa fa-edit"></i></a>
 	<form id="patientIntakeDataForm" url="/api/client/updateCanvasData" class="mcp-theme-1" right>
+		@if($patient->canvas_data)
+			@include('app.patient.intake-data.patient-intake-data-display')
+		@endif
 		<input type="hidden" name="uid" value="{{$patient->uid}}">
-		<input type="hidden" name="key" name="INTAKE_DATA">
+		<input type="hidden" name="key" value="INTAKE_DATA">
 		<input type="hidden" name="data">
 		<div class="mb-2">
 			<label class="text-secondary text-sm">Height</label>
@@ -50,6 +53,7 @@
 	</form>
 </div>
 
+
 <script>
 	(function() {
 		function init() {

+ 1 - 1
resources/views/layouts/patient.blade.php

@@ -673,7 +673,7 @@ $isOldClient = (date_diff(date_create(config('app.point_impl_date')), date_creat
 									</section>
 									<section class="mr-4 align-self-start mt-2 ml-auto">
 										<label>Intake Data:</label> <span class="text-secondary"></span>
-											@include('layouts.patient-intake-data-form')
+											@include('app.patient.intake-data.patient-intake-data-form')
 									</section>
 									<ul class="vbox mt-2 align-self-start patient-header-address ">
 										<li class="d-flex align-items-start">